Iconic Memory
A component of the visual memory system which is a brief, transient visual representation of a scene.
Sensory Memory
Sensory memory is the shortest-term element of memory which allows individuals to retain impressions of sensory information after the original stimulus has ceased.
Short-Term Memory
A component of the human memory system that is capable of holding a small amount of information in conscious awareness for a brief period.
Mnemonic
A memory aid, usually a pattern or technique that assists in the learning and memorization of information.
